The process of lipid metabolism synthesizes and degrades the lipid stores and produces the structural and functional lipids characteristic of individual tissues. Two main subtypes of lipids include sterols, like cholesterols, and those containing fatty acids. A lipid is any of various organic compounds that are insoluble in water

It is customary to call a lipid a fat if it is solid at 25Β°c, and oil if it is a liquid at the same temperature A lipid is defined as a biomolecule that is highly soluble in nonpolar solvents but largely insoluble in polar solvents, such as water These differences in melting points reflect diffeΒ­rences in the degree of unsaturation of the constituent fatty acids.

In the human body, these molecules can be synthesized in the liver and are found in oil, butter, whole milk, cheese, fried foods and also in some red meats

Let us have a detailed look at the lipid structure, properties, types and classification of lipids They form the lipid bilayer, ensuring cellular boundary integrity and enabling selective permeability Triglycerides are the most common type of lipid in the body and come from fats and oils in the diet Triglycerides are key to energy production

Phospholipids make up the outer protective layer of cells in the body. Lipids are important for your body to be able to make and use energy, vitamins and hormones, for example A lipid panel can tell you if you have the right amounts. Lipids structure lipid monomers are glycerol and fatty acids

The lipid structure is as follows

Fatty acids are a type of lipids that consists of long hydrocarbon chains with a carboxyl group (cooh) at one end In lipids, such as triglycerides, the glycerol molecule function as a backbone. Lipids are fatty compounds that perform a range of essential functions in the body Phospholipids, steroids, and triglycerides are examples of lipids
